Low Carb Diet Secrets Revealed!

You may be considering a low carb diet program, but wonder if they really work, and if so, how well?

Let's take the mystery out of low carb diets by giving you the 3 most important elements to their success.

First, you need to bring your carboydrate cravings under control. Some diet programs argue that most of us are addicted to carbohydrates. Others take a more moderate approach and link it to the glycemic index.

All of the low carb diets are consistent on this one fact though - you need to overcome short-term cravings to ensure long term weight loss success.

There is definite scientific proof linking simple carbohydrates, such as sugar, to cravings you have for more food.

Second, you need to focus on better carbs versus the worse carbs. What that means is simply that you must consider which carbohydrates result in more glucose spikes being created by your body.

Simple carbs are quickly absorbed and result in significant glucose spikes which, can result in more fat being stored in your body. Low carb diets balance overall carbohydrate input with the quality and type of carbohydrates.

Just by reducing the simple carbs in your diet such as sugar, milk, some fruit you can make a big difference in curbing your cravings for more food.

Third, you must gain confidence in the delicious foods you are able to eat on low carb diets so that you stick with the change. You cannot expect to achieve long term success with your diet program if you are not educated or satisfied with the amazing alternative foods at your disposal.

Low carb diets can lead to weight loss, health benefits and an entire lifestyle change - however you don't have to give up everything you enjoy in order to experience rapid weight loss.

By focusing on foods that trigger chemical and biological reactions in your body resulting in cravings, you can burn fat and increase your health at the same time.
